Handover Note — Annual Billing Migration

For the finance team's continuity: the shift of all Pellwick accounts to annual billing is sixty percent complete. Deferred revenue schedules have been restated through Q3; reconciliations are current as of last close. Watch the proration logic on mid-cycle upgrades — it caused two adjustments already. The underlying commercial reasoning is summarised in the confidential note below.

internal memo for tajof-kaduf: Only 65 of the 511 pilot accounts renewed Lamdor, so a churn review is set for January 26. Aldmirek Works is in early talks to buy Alddorox Works for about $490.9 million.

**Q: How do reviewers verify the Bramblehook partner SFTP drop?**

A: Partner files land in the Tindervale drop zone hourly, and the ingest job on Copperline validates checksums before anything moves downstream. When reviewing changes to the drop handler, confirm the retry window stays at three attempts and that quarantine logic still fires on malformed manifests. Staging credentials rotate weekly, so don't hardcode them. If you need to re-key the staging drop during review, use the recovery passphrase listed directly below.

unlock words, kagef-taduf: fenir-quenix-norwyn-sorvan-gormir-gorir-fraok

# Artifact Signing — Corveld Metrics Sidecar

All Corveld sidecar images and their aggregation-rule bundles are signed before publication to the Ashgrove registry. The build pipeline signs automatically on tagged commits; manual signing is only for hotfix rebuilds, and must be logged in the release ledger. Verification happens at pull time in the admission hook — unsigned or mismatched artifacts are rejected, no exceptions. Future maintainers: rotate annually and update this page when you do. The current signing key is below.

rollout seal: bky3_eGt